Product Details
- A flush fitting, inset handle with pull-out ring pull.
- Ideal for use on bi-folding doors, cupboards, kitchen cabinet doors, wardrobes and trapdoors and sliding doors.
- The ring sits flush within the rectangular backplate when not in use. It can then be pulled out from the plate to allow you to open your door.
- This item has to be morticed (cut) into the door to allow it to sit fit flush.
- Shiny polished brass finish.
Finish Details
- Made from solid brass
- Polished brass (lacquered)

Why "Registered Architectural Ironmonger" matters
RegAI is the recognised professional standard for specifying door hardware — covering fire compliance, function, handing and finish. Most online sellers aren't qualified to give it. When you buy from us, a real RegAI specialist stands behind the choice, so you fit the right product first time.
